The 3M 1630 Tegaderm I.V. Transparent Film Dressing Frame Style is a sterile, vapour permeable transparent film dressing designed to cover and protect catheter sites and wounds, while also securing devices to the skin. It is ideal for use in various clinical areas such as Dialysis Centres, Emergency Medical Services (EMS), Surgery, Cardiovascular, Critical Care, Emergency Room, I.V. Therapy, Intensive Care, Pediatric, and Radiology.
This dressing enhances patient comfort with its soft, porous and breathable design. Its unique non-adherent pad will not stick to the wound, allowing for normal healing with less pain and trauma. The absorbent pad also protects the wound and absorbs drainage, while allowing the exchange of moisture and oxygen, reducing the risk of skin maceration.
The dressing provides excellent adhesion, yet is gentle to the skin and does not contain natural rubber latex. It is easy to apply, conforms to body contours, and flexes with movement or swelling. This all-in-one dressing is designed to reduce application time and is available in a wide range of sizes for most common applications.
The dressing is waterproof and provides a sterile barrier that protects the I.V. site or wound from external contaminants such as bacteria, viruses, blood and body fluids. In vitro testing shows that the transparent film provides a viral barrier from viruses 27 nm in diameter or larger while the dressing remains intact without leakage.
The transparency of the dressing allows for continuous visibility to the I.V. insertion site. It can be worn up to 7 days and is radiologically transparent, meaning Tegaderm products can be safely left on patients skin during radiotherapy treatments. The dressing does not act as bolus material, with or without 3M Cavilon No Sting Barrier Film (CNSBF).
The 3M 1630 Tegaderm Transparent Film Dressing Frame Style can also be used to maintain a moist wound environment to facilitate autolytic debridement and helps to prevent skin breakdown caused by friction. It is hypoallergenic and comes in a pack of 50 units.
